Pre Care Instructions

  • What to Avoid

    If approved by your primary care provider, avoid all blood thinners 48-72hrs before having your injection. This may include NSAIDs such as; Aspirin, Ibuprofen, Aleve, Motrin, etc., Supplements such as; Vitamin E, Fish Oil, Garlic, Ginseng, St. John’s Wort, Ginkgo Biloba, and Primrose oil.

    Alcohol is also consider a blood thinner and should be avoided 1 week pre/post treatment.

    Avoid any micro-blading at least 2 weeks pre treatment.

    Pre Care

    Arnica is optional pre/post treatment to minimize bruising, swelling, and redness.

    Remember

    If possible, come to your appointment with a clean face, free of make-up.

    Contraindications for Treatment

    We will not treat you with neurotoxins if you are pregnant, breastfeeding, or have an active infection. You must get clearance from your primary care physician if you have a bleeding/clotting or autoimmune/neurological disorder.

  • Pre-Care (1-2 Weeks Before):

    • Avoid Sun Exposure: Minimize direct sun exposure and tanning beds for at least 2 weeks. Sunburned skin cannot be treated.

    • Discontinue Irritating Topicals: Stop using retinoids (Retin-A, Retinol), AHAs, BHAs, Vitamin C (low pH formulas), exfoliants, and topical antibiotics for 5-7 days prior.

    • Medications: Consult your physician about discontinuing blood-thinning medications (e.g., Aspirin, Ibuprofen, Advil, Motrin, Aleve, Naproxen) for at least 3-7 days prior, as these can increase bruising and interfere with the inflammatory response crucial for results. Avoid anti-inflammatory medications for at least 3 days prior.

    • Cold Sores: If you have a history of cold sores, inform your provider and take an antiviral medication as prescribed, starting 2 days before your treatment.

    • Other Treatments: Avoid IPL/Laser procedures for at least 2 weeks prior.

    • Hair Removal: Avoid waxing, depilatory creams, or electrolysis on the treatment area for 5-7 days prior. Shave the area the day before, not the day of, to avoid irritation.

  • Pre-Care (1-2 Weeks Before):

    • Hydration: Drink plenty of water (at least 64 oz/day) for 3-5 days leading up to your appointment to ensure easy blood draw and optimal plasma quality.

    • Avoid Blood Thinners: Consult your physician about discontinuing blood-thinning medications (e.g., Aspirin, Ibuprofen, Advil, Motrin, Aleve, Naproxen) and supplements (e.g., Vitamin E, Fish Oil, Omega 3/6, Ginkgo Biloba, Garlic, Flax Oil, Cod Liver Oil) for at least 1 week prior to minimize bruising and bleeding.

    • Steroids: Discontinue oral corticosteroids (e.g., Prednisone) at least 2 weeks prior, as they can impede the effectiveness of PRP/PRF.

    • Alcohol & Caffeine: Avoid alcohol, excessive caffeine, and spicy foods for at least 3-5 days before treatment, as they may increase bruising and reduce treatment efficacy.

    • Smoking: Avoid smoking for at least 3-5 days prior, as it can impair healing.

    • Cold Sores: If you have a history of cold sores, inform your provider and consider starting an antiviral medication (e.g., Valtrex) as prescribed, on the day of or the day before treatment.

    • Meal: Eat a healthy meal before your appointment to maintain stable blood sugar.

Post Care Instructions

  • What to Avoid

    Avoid wearing a tight hat or headband for at least 4 hours post treatment. Additionally, refrain from massaging or applying pressure to the treated area during this time.

    Avoid strenuous exercise/activity for 24-48 hours post treatment.

    For 4 hours after your treatment, it’s important to avoid lying flat. This helps ensure that the Botox or Dysport remains in place and doesn’t migrate.

    Avoid makeup application for at least 24 hours after treatment.

    Avoid any micro-blading at least 2 weeks post treatment.

    Avoid blood thinning agents if approved by your primary care physician and alcohol for 48-72hrs. Alcohol can increase swelling and bruising, so skipping it will help speed up the recovery process.

    Remember

    Remember to always be patient with results which can take up to 2-3 weeks to appear. It’s important to give your body time to adjust. We will not administer any additional injections until after this period has passed.

    Follow-Up Appointment

    After 2 weeks, if you feel the need for any adjustments or a dosage increase, schedule a follow-up with your injector. This will give us time to assess the results and make any needed tweaks.

    Longevity and Movement

    Botox and Dysport typically last for 3-4 months, but it's normal to see some movement return gradually between 6-10 weeks as the treatment starts to wear off.

    Treatment Area Monitoring

    Call our office immediately if the treated areas become red or hot to the touch days after your treatment. This could indicate an issue that requires attention.

    Arnica for Bruising

    You may continue taking Arnica to help accelerate the healing of any bruising and reduce swelling.

  • Post-Care (Immediate to 1 Week After):

    • Gentle Cleansing: For the first 24 hours, rinse the treated area with tepid water. After 24 hours, use only a gentle cleanser for the next 3 days, patting dry with clean hands.

    • Moisturize: Apply only the recommended post-treatment balm or moisturizer frequently (every 2-3 hours) for the first few days.

    • Avoid Active Ingredients: Do NOT use any Alpha Hydroxy Acids, Beta Hydroxy Acids, Retinoids (Vitamin A), or anything perceived as "active" skincare for at least 3-7 days.

    • Sun Protection: Avoid direct sun exposure and tanning beds for at least 2 weeks. After 24 hours, apply a broad-spectrum mineral-based sunscreen (SPF 30+) daily and reapply every 60-90 minutes when outdoors.

    • Makeup: Avoid makeup for at least 24 hours after treatment. If applying makeup after 24 hours, use mineral makeup and ensure brushes are clean.

    • Exercise & Heat: Avoid strenuous exercise, excessive sweating, jacuzzis, saunas, and steam baths for at least 24-48 hours (or longer if skin is still irritated).

    • Picking/Peeling: Do NOT pick, scratch, or scrub at any flaking or peeling skin. Allow it to shed naturally.

    • Hydration & Nutrition: Stay well-hydrated and focus on nutrient-rich foods to support skin healing.

    • Pain Relief: If needed, Tylenol is acceptable for discomfort. Avoid NSAIDs (Motrin, Ibuprofen) for at least 2 weeks post-treatment as they can interfere with the beneficial inflammatory process.

  • Post-Care (Immediate to 1 Week After):

    • No Touching/Rubbing: Do NOT touch, press, rub, or manipulate the treated area(s) for at least 8 hours after your treatment.

    • Avoid Active Ingredients & Makeup: Do not apply any lotions, creams, or makeup to the treated area for at least 6-8 hours.

    • Avoid Anti-Inflammatories: Continue to AVOID NSAIDs (Aspirin, Ibuprofen, Motrin, Aleve, etc.) for at least 1-2 weeks after your procedure, as these can interfere with the essential inflammatory response that PRP/PRF relies on for regeneration.

    • Pain Relief: If you experience discomfort, Tylenol (Acetaminophen) is acceptable.

    • Ice/Heat: Avoid applying ice or heat directly to the injection site for the first 24-72 hours, as this can limit the necessary inflammatory process.

    • Exercise & Heat: Avoid vigorous exercise, sun exposure, and excessive heat (saunas, hot baths, steam rooms) for at least 24-48 hours.

    • Alcohol & Smoking: Continue to avoid alcohol and smoking for at least 3-5 days (ideally longer) post-procedure, as they can hinder the healing process and reduce effectiveness.

    • Hydration & Diet: Maintain a healthy diet and continue to drink plenty of water (at least 64 oz/day) to support healing.

    • Expected Side Effects: It is normal to experience some bruising, redness, mild swelling, itching, and soreness at the injection sites. These typically resolve within a few days to a week.

    • Sleeping: Consider sleeping with your head elevated (for facial treatments) to minimize swelling.

  • Post-Care (Ongoing):

    • Monitor Side Effects: Pay close attention to any potential side effects such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, constipation, or injection site reactions. These are common, especially when starting or increasing doses.

    • Hydration is Key: Drink plenty of water throughout the day, especially if you experience digestive side effects like nausea or constipation, as this can help mitigate them.

    • Balanced Diet: Continue to focus on a balanced diet rich in lean proteins, fruits, and vegetables. Due to reduced appetite, it's vital to ensure you're getting adequate nutrition from a variety of food sources.

    • Light Physical Activity: Maintain regular, light to moderate physical activity. This complements the medication's effects and supports overall health. Do not push through pain.

    • Stress Management: Practice stress-reducing techniques (e.g., deep breathing, mindfulness, adequate sleep), as stress can impact weight management.

    • Follow Dosing Schedule: Adhere strictly to your prescribed dosage and weekly injection schedule. If a dose is missed, follow your provider's specific instructions on when to take it or if to skip it. Do not double dose.

    • Injection Site Care: Keep the injection site clean and dry. Minor redness or swelling is normal; avoid rubbing or scratching the area.

    • Regular Check-ins: Attend all scheduled follow-up appointments with your Ruma provider. These are crucial for monitoring your progress, managing any side effects, and adjusting your treatment plan as needed.

    • Report Concerns: Contact your provider immediately if you experience severe or persistent side effects, or any concerning symptoms (e.g., severe abdominal pain, persistent vomiting/diarrhea, vision changes, signs of an allergic reaction).
